Episode: Trophy Trout, Nesting Terns, Groton State Forest

Lawrence Pyne heads to Waterbury, Vt., to fish for trophy trout on the Winooski River. Four Lake Champlain islands are important nesting areas for common terns, and they're part of the Audubon Society's important bird area program. A look at Groton State Forest's Becoming an Outdoor Family program, which hosts an annual event to help families enjoy the outdoors.
